1. Standard MIL-STD-1913 Rails
The most common type of AR-15 rail system is the MIL-STD-1913, also known as the Picatinny rail. This standard was established by the United States Department of Defense and is widely used in the military and civilian sectors. The Picatinny rail features a series of slots that allow for the attachment of various accessories, such as scopes, flashlights, and lasers.
One of the key advantages of the Picatinny rail is its compatibility with a wide range of accessories. This is due to the standardized dimensions of the slots, which ensure that accessories from different manufacturers will fit seamlessly. Additionally, the Picatinny rail is known for its durability and strength, making it a reliable choice for both recreational and professional shooters.

4. Free-Float Rails
For those looking to maximize the accuracy of their AR-15 rifle, a free-float rail system is the way to go. Free-float rails are designed to allow the barrel to move independently of the handguard, reducing the amount of flex and vibration that can affect accuracy.
Free-float rails are typically made from lightweight materials, such as aluminum or polymer, to minimize the overall weight of the rifle. They are also designed to be compatible with a wide range of accessories, including those designed for traditional Picatinny and M-LOK rails.
One of the key advantages of a free-float rail system is its ability to improve the rifle’s accuracy. By reducing the amount of flex and vibration, shooters can enjoy more consistent and accurate shots, making it an excellent choice for those who prioritize accuracy over all else.
